Why You Pick The Area Rug First

There is an article about area rugs in the OC Registers life section of their online paper. It is an excellent article about some of the new trends in area rug fashion. It rightly emphasizes the importance of the rug as the basis of your room design. Professional designers pick the rug first to define the palette of colors for the rest of the room.


…designers like to start with the rug when outfitting an interior, pulling out one or more of its colors for upholstery, walls and window treatments, as well as accessories such as pillows, lamp shades and even flowers in a vase. OC Register


The rug, as the basis of the room décor, needs to visually tie the other colors in the room together. Buying furniture and other furnishings and then trying to find a rug that has those colors is much tougher than doing it the other way around.


But most people buy furniture first, considering rugs an accessory. With the more visually provocative rugs, that can be a challenge. OC Register


The best procedure to decorating a room from scratch is to pick an area rug in the color array you like best and build the room around that.
